Why it was recalled

A potential software failure related to the Worklist functionality has been identified on a subset of Innova 2100IQ, 3100IQ and 4100IQ systems. When using the Worklist function to import patient data to Innova, there are two scenarios that will cause the next exam to fail and the inability to recall acquired sequences.

Root cause (FDA determination)

Software design

Action the firm took

Consignees were sent on 3/24/10, a GE Healthcare " Urgent Medical Device Correction" letter dated March 23, 2010. The letter included the Safety Issue, Affected Product Details, Product Correction and Contact Information.
